Spotting Reliable Payment Methods and Smooth Transactions

Choosing an online casino isn’t just about games—it’s also about how easily you can deposit and withdraw funds. Payment methods shape much of the user experience, and the best online casinos tend to support a range of options, from classic credit cards like Visa and MasterCard to e-wallets such as PayPal and Skrill. Some newer platforms even accept cryptocurrencies, adding an extra layer of privacy and speed.

Timely withdrawals are a hallmark of reputable casinos. Nothing kills the fun faster than waiting weeks to see your winnings. A casino that promises 24 to 48-hour payouts and sticks to it gains my respect. It’s worth checking if the casino uses instant verification technologies like BankID in certain regions, streamlining the process and reducing friction.

The Importance of Responsible Gaming in Online Casinos

While exploring the best online casinos, it’s essential to remember that gambling should always be a form of entertainment, not a source of stress. Many leading casinos provide tools to help players stay in control, such as de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and time reminders. Using these features keeps the experience enjoyable and can prevent problematic behavior.

An “Accredited Investor” (as defined in NI 45 106) is:

  • a person registered under the securities legislation of a jurisdiction of Canada, as an adviser or dealer, other than a person registered solely as a limited market dealer under one or both of the Securities Act (Ontario) or the Securities Act (Newfoundland and Labrador); or
  • an individual registered or formerly registered under the securities legislation of a jurisdiction of Canada as a representative of a person referred to in paragraph (a); or
  • an individual who, either alone or with a spouse, beneficially owns financial assets having an aggregate realizable value that before taxes, but net of any related liabilities, exceeds $1,000,000; or
  • an individual whose net income before taxes exceeded $200,000 in each of the two most recent calendar years or whose net income before taxes combined with that of a spouse exceeded $300,000 in each of the two most recent calendar years and who, in either case, reasonably expects to exceed that net income level in the current calendar year; or
  • an individual who, either alone or with a spouse, has net assets of at least $5,000,000; or
  • a person, other than an individual or investment fund, that has net assets of at least $5,000,000 as shown on its most recently prepared financial statements; or
  • a trust company or trust corporation registered or authorized to carry on business under the Trust and Loan Companies Act (Canada) or under comparable legislation in a jurisdiction of Canada or a foreign jurisdiction, acting on behalf of a fully managed account managed by the trust company or trust corporation, as the case may be; or
  • an investment fund that distributes or has distributed its securities only to (i) a person that is or was an accredited investor at the time of the distribution, (ii) a person that acquires or acquired securities in the circumstances referred to in sections 2.10 of NI 45 106 [Minimum amount investment] or 2.19 of NI 45 106 [Additional investment in investment funds], or (iii) a person described in paragraph (i) or (ii) that acquires or acquired securities under section 2.18 of NI 45 106 [Investment fund reinvestment];
  • a person acting on behalf of a fully managed account managed by that person, if that person is registered or authorized to carry on business as an adviser or the equivalent under the securities legislation of a jurisdiction of Canada or a foreign jurisdiction; or
  • a person in respect of which all of the owners of interests, direct, indirect or beneficial, except the voting securities required by law to be owned by directors, are persons that are accredited investors (as defined in NI 45 106); or
  • an investment fund that is advised by a person registered as an adviser or a person that is exempt from registration as an adviser.

Note that as of 2016, many provinces in Canada now allow non-accredited investors to invest in private markets – under specified limits.
